Online learning is raging due to the offered advantages including the ease of information accessibility and flexible learning experiences remotely. However, it still lacks intelligent authentication and validation of users at the other end. Additional questions are raised for the effectiveness of transfer of knowledge, soft skills, and value of education as the student's engagement. Following the hype and crucial need for full-fledged virtual learning environments (VLEs) in recent times, the literature has witnessed a significant increase in the studies targeting the associated problem areas. The existing VLEs in place fail to provide aggregated functionalities of student authentication and activity tracking in dynamic visual environments. To solve the problem by providing interactive functionality, an automated hybrid information activity system (HIAS) based on facial biometrics, facial emotion recognition using computer vision techniques is proposed. The proposed system solves the problem intelligently by analysing the incoming online video from the tutor's computer screen. © 2023 Inderscience Enterprises Ltd.
